Hello Guys

 

Im at the final stages of an online ordering system and have to send the details of the order to the database software that our company uses - Goldmine. This is done via a web import process that picks up emails sent to a certain address with the required fields and values in.

 

Now the problem is: The version of Goldmine we use is an absolute dinosaur and uses loads of symbols that are special or reserved characters in many programming languages  >:( in particular, the 'to' address for all web-import emails have to follow an exact syntax - {$GM-WEBIMPORT$} <[email protected]> - and that's hard-coded into the program. When I try and send to this address using PHP's mail() function, I get a "550 delivery is not allowed to this address" error; which im assuming is being caused because PHP is looking for a variable called $GM-WEBIMPORT or something. I've tried escaping all the symbols using their ASCII equivalent and splitting them up into strings etc, but I still can't get it to work. Our Goldmine 'Technical Contact' was just as puzzled on the phone and actually said "hmm well im sure there is a workaround because lots of our customers must import using PHP"! 

 

My Plan B was to come on here and see if you guys have any suggestions!  8)
